Exactly How Roofing Ventilation Functions



Effective roofing ventilation counts on the natural activity of air to develop an equilibrium in between intake and exhaust. When you set up vents, you're basically permitting fresh air to enter your attic while allowing hot, stagnant air to leave. This process helps manage temperature level and dampness degrees, preventing concerns like mold growth and roof covering damage.

Intake vents, generally found at the eaves, pull in amazing air from outdoors. At the same time, exhaust vents, situated near the ridge of the roof covering, allow hot air surge and exit. The difference in temperature level develops an all-natural air movement, called the pile effect. As cozy air surges, it creates a vacuum that draws in cooler air from the reduced vents.

To maximize this system, you require to make certain that the consumption and exhaust vents are appropriately sized and placed. If the intake is restricted, you will not accomplish the wanted air flow.

Likewise, not enough exhaust can catch warm and dampness, causing possible damage.

Secret Installation Factors To Consider



When setting up roofing system air flow, several vital considerations can make or break your system's efficiency. First, you require to examine your roof's layout. The pitch, shape, and products all affect air movement and ventilation option. See to it to pick vents that fit your roof kind and local climate conditions.

Next off, take into consideration the placement of your vents. Ideally, you'll desire a balanced system with consumption and exhaust vents placed for optimum air movement. Location consumption vents low on the roofing and exhaust vents near the top to encourage an all-natural flow of air. This setup helps prevent wetness build-up and advertises power performance.


Don't forget about insulation. Correct insulation in your attic prevents warmth from getting away and keeps your home comfy. Ensure that insulation does not block your vents, as this can prevent air movement.

Last but not least, consider upkeep. Select ventilation systems that are easy to accessibility for cleaning and inspection. Normal maintenance ensures your system continues to operate effectively with time.
